being a rather experienced php-dev i just decided to use smarty in a new project. so i read the manual, some tuts and more and i am still not sure as how to implement it best. (which probably just means that i read so many tuts i forgot the manual again allready Wink

The problem i am facing should be rather common and easy to solve, so i am sorry if i am overlooking something basic here:

i would just like to use some subtemplates or rather subcontent, which is not defined in the contentfile, but in the template- meaning i have special tabledefinition and i need that many times in my template, but alwas using a different databaseresult in there.
so what i would need is to say in the templatefile to include at a some place a content file (which then gets the small templatefile, asks the database, puts the result in the template and returns the resulting table into the main layout.)
if that was to confused to understand just have a look at http://mikro.homeip.net/fewo.neu/ : i am talking about the table on the left and on the right..

could anybody please explain to me how this is done?
